Key Features
- Marmot NanoPro membrane: provides waterproof and breathable performance so users stay dry without feeling overheated on active outings.
- PFC-Free DWR technology: sheds water effectively while avoiding perfluorinated chemicals for more environmentally conscious water repellency.
- 100% seam-taped construction: ensures complete leak-proof protection where seams often fail in lightweight shells.
- Pit zips for ventilation: let wearers dump excess heat during strenuous uphill sections or when the weather breaks.
- Stows into its own pocket: makes the jacket simple to pack away into a pack or tote when conditions improve.
- Adjustable hem and cuffs: keep cold air out and let users fine-tune fit for layering or mobility.
Who It's For
The Precip Eco suits outdoors-oriented women who want a dependable rain layer that travels light, breathes during activity, and packs away when not needed. Hikers, multi-day walkers, city commuters and anyone who values waterproofing combined with a slim, low-bulk profile will appreciate its balance of features and portability.
Shoppers who need a heavy insulated coat for winter or a tailored, fashion-first raincoat should look elsewhere; this is a technical lightweight shell designed for wet-weather protection and active ventilation rather than warmth or formal wear. Also, those who prefer a roomy cut around hips may want to try one size up, as fit feedback is mixed.

Specifications
| Brand | Marmot |
| Model | Precip Eco Waterproof Rain Jacket |
| Waterproof Technology | Marmot NanoPro membrane |
| Durable Water Repellency | PFC-Free DWR |
| Seams | 100% seam-taped construction |
| Ventilation | Pit zips |
| Packing | Stows into its own pocket |

Frequently Asked Questions
Is this jacket fully waterproof?
Yes, the NanoPro membrane plus 100% seam-taped construction provide full waterproof protection.
Will it keep me warm in cold rain?
It is a lightweight shell intended for wet-weather protection and ventilation, not insulation; layer underneath for warmth.
Can I pack it into a daypack?
Yes, it stows into its own pocket for compact storage and easy carrying.
